Never Thought I'd See It
But Chester Frazier has Illinois fans recommending him for league MVP... It's unrealistic considering his shooting is so poor that the shots he does take are largely just to keep defenses honest, but after the kind of abuse that fell on his shoulders from the fans last season, it's great to see him going out with that kind of respect from people who love the program and pony up to keep it going.
He's a class act who's been through far too much the past three years, very gratifying to see him finishing his time here on top. I'll be interested in seeing where he starts his coaching career next year.
Also of interest in the world of college basketball, John Gasaway, formerly of Big Ten Wonk fame and now at Basketball Prospectus, is unilaterally renaming the standard deviation measurement. I think it'll stick, for a few years at least.
